Output fccaa88e35f2894c0b45a20f4ae57b66a11609adadb97efb8c9efe4053b98d32:1

value
981020475
script pubkey
OP_0 OP_PUSHBYTES_20 56afb3353577c25ea60ea00e40a19bf9b7c9d12d
address
tb1q26hmxdf4wlp9afsw5q8ypgvmlxmun5fd6cv8h3
transaction
fccaa88e35f2894c0b45a20f4ae57b66a11609adadb97efb8c9efe4053b98d32